Neumann/Smith is a firm specializing in architecture, interior design, and planning, with a history dating back to 1968. The firm is known for its creative problem-solving approach and has worked across various market sectors, including multi-family, academic, and community projects. Neumann/Smith operates from its headquarters in Southfield, Michigan, and a strategic partnership office in Detroit.

The firm focuses on delivering bespoke designs tailored to each client's vision, leveraging in-studio collaboration and decades of experience. Their services include architecture, interior design, and planning, with a commitment to creating spaces that inspire and endure. Neumann/Smith emphasizes a client-focused approach, ensuring that each project is unique and meets the specific needs of the owner and community.

Notable projects include the Michigan Central Station Interior Fit Out and the Beverly Center renovation. The firm has received recognition such as the AIA Michigan Firm of the Year Award, reflecting its dedication to quality and impactful design. Neumann/Smith's influence extends throughout Michigan and across the United States, providing clients with the expertise of a national firm and the familiarity of a local partner.
